This print is part of a suite of fifteen plates dating to 1661, dedicated to the Rostaing family by Henry Chesneau. In this print at center is the coat of arms at top center supported by two swans. At left, a portrait of Louis-Henry, marquis de Rostaing, 1661. Below, the Pope is seated between kings. In the niche at left are three fates and in the niche at right are Mars, Aesculapius and Themis.
